I woul like to send some letters using MS Word and its function for merging
the addresses of Outlook Contacts.
When I choose Contacts as data source everything works well out of ........
... the field "Name" in the select mask is empty, seaching  for a name I
find the contact only in the field "show contact as", if I use "Contacts" to
put a single address in a letter (without the merge procedure) it works.
Someaone has a idea of what could be wrong?

For best results, display your contacts folder in Outlook and use the Tools | Mail Merge command there to start the merge.
